Screening for Chlamydia trachomatis in low-risk obstetric patients

Routine prenatal screening for Chlamydia trachomatis (C. trachomatis) is not cost-effective for low-risk obstetric patients. A study found significantly lower prevalence in this group, questioning universal screening protocols.
Area of Science:
- Obstetrics and Gynecology
- Infectious Diseases
- Public Health
Background:
- Chlamydia trachomatis (C. trachomatis) is a common sexually transmitted infection (STI) that can impact obstetric outcomes.
- Prenatal screening for STIs is crucial for maternal and infant health.
- Determining the most effective screening strategies, such as selective vs. universal approaches, is an ongoing challenge in obstetric care.
Purpose of the Study:
- To determine the prevalence of Chlamydia trachomatis in a rural obstetric population.
- To evaluate the appropriateness of selective versus universal prenatal screening for C. trachomatis.
Main Methods:
- A cohort of 1,587 patients attending their first prenatal visit between April 1991 and May 1993 were screened for C. trachomatis using an antigen test.
- Patients were categorized into high-risk (unmarried, <20 years old, history of STD) and low-risk groups.
Main Results:
- The overall prevalence of C. trachomatis was 2.0%.
- Low-risk patients (n=1,128) had a significantly lower prevalence (0.5%) compared to high-risk patients (n=459) (5.7%) (P < 0.001).
- Confidence intervals for low-risk and high-risk groups were 95% CI 0.2-1.2 and 95% CI 3.7-8.2, respectively.
Conclusions:
- Universal prenatal screening for C. trachomatis is not appropriate for low-risk patients in this rural obstetric population.
- Selective screening based on identified risk factors may be a more targeted and efficient approach.
- Further research may be needed to refine risk stratification for C. trachomatis screening in diverse obstetric populations.
